The Magnolia House

You and your family will love this 100 year old fully restored home with its original hard wood floors, brand new chef’s kitchen, the 75’ TV and the extra large couch. Plan to pack your beach towels, your favorite swim suit and make yourself at home here in our Magnolia House. Located only 2 blocks from Maddox and only 5 miles from the beach. The bike trail to the beach starts right in our backyard. We hope to have created a space you can’t wait to come back to.
The space
Linens included/No Smoking/No pets

Side door entryway opens to the laundry room with a washing machine and dryer. The 1st floor has a full kitchen with all amenities. Bar seating. Open concept living room. Watch the game while you cook. Off the kitchen is a Full bathroom.
Please note -We have plants everywhere in this house so we have a very strict no pet policy as many of the plants are toxic to animals.

Going upstairs there is a small bathroom/European rain shower which is very fun and our guests love! Both bedrooms are upstairs as well with the office in the middle - which provides great privacy to each bedroom. The bedrooms each have queen (super comfortable) beds and a TV. We provide crisp white cotton sheets on all of our beds.

Saving the best for last, our favorite space is the 3rd floor walkup attic converted into a loft/living room. The 3rd queen bed is up here on one side and a sectional couch on the other side facing a 55” TV. On this side of the attic there is plenty of space for an air mattress if needed.
With the high vaulted ceilings our attic makes rainy days so lovely!
This 1500 square foot home is super cozy & comfortable.

Wonderful property!

We would 100% return to Magnolia House for our future trips to Chincoteague. The house itself has loads of character and the hosts have obviously put a lot of effort and care into modernizing it. It is exactly as depicted in listing. Kitchen has everything you could need, even though we didn't cook! But no worries, the house is in reasonable walking distance to of many dining and shopping options, but off Maddox so it's a nice quiet street. Go meet the ponies down Anderson Ave or Charlie the Great Dane at Church St Produce. The house has a large backyard if you have little ones to entertain. Ample AC power, hot water, washing machine that actually works! Jess has thought of so many appreciated thoughtful extras -- a jar of hair ties! Loved the live plants, the comfortable beds, nice linens. The house is 100 years old, so the stairs are steep and the steps narrow, and wooden. Just something to keep in mind if anyone in your party has limited mobility. 5 stars from this family!
